A professional HVAC service call in Progress starts with a full system diagnostic. Your technician will check refrigerant levels, test electrical connections, examine the blower motor and capacitors, and inspect ductwork for leaks or obstructions. This comprehensive approach identifies not just the immediate problem, but potential issues that could cause a breakdown during peak demand — which in TX's hot and arid climate, can be dangerous.

For Progress homeowners considering a new HVAC system, sizing is everything. An undersized unit runs constantly, driving up bills without adequately heating or cooling your home. An oversized unit short-cycles, creating humidity problems and premature wear. Professional contractors perform a Manual J load calculation that factors in your home's square footage, insulation R-values, window area, orientation, and TX's specific climate zone data.

“My AC is running but not cooling the house”
This is the most common HVAC complaint. Causes include low refrigerant from a leak, a dirty or frozen evaporator coil, a failed compressor, a bad capacitor, or a thermostat malfunction.
Check your air filter first and replace it if dirty. If the problem persists, call an HVAC technician. They will check refrigerant levels, inspect the coil, test electrical components, and diagnose the exact cause.
“My energy bill suddenly got really high”
A sudden spike in heating or cooling costs often means your HVAC system is working harder than it should. Common causes include refrigerant leaks, dirty coils reducing efficiency, a failing compressor, or duct leaks losing conditioned air to unconditioned spaces.
Schedule an HVAC tune-up and energy audit. A technician will clean coils, check refrigerant, inspect ductwork, and identify any component that is causing your system to run inefficiently.

Texas ACR License
Texas requires HVAC technicians to hold a license from the Texas Department of Licensing and Regulation (TDLR) Air Conditioning and Refrigeration program. EPA Section 608 certification is also required for refrigerant handling.

Seasonal HVAC Maintenance Tips for Progress Homeowners
Proactive maintenance by season helps you avoid expensive hvac repair & installation emergencies.
Schedule your AC tune-up before summer demand. Technicians are booked solid in July. Early scheduling gets you better availability and sometimes early-bird pricing.
Change your air filter monthly during peak cooling season. A clogged filter makes your AC work 15 percent harder, costing you money on every utility bill.
Schedule your furnace inspection before heating season. Technicians check for carbon monoxide leaks, cracked heat exchangers, and dirty burners that reduce efficiency.
Keep vents and registers clear of furniture and rugs. Blocked vents force your furnace to work harder and can cause dangerous overheating.
Should You Repair or Replace? — HVAC Decision Guide
Use this framework to make the right financial decision for your Progress home.
🔧 Consider Repairing When...
- System is less than 10 years old
- Repair cost is under $1,000
- First major repair on this unit
- System still uses current refrigerant (R-410A)
- Energy bills haven't increased significantly
🔄 Consider Replacing When...
- System is 15+ years old
- Repair cost exceeds 50% of replacement cost
- Uses discontinued R-22 refrigerant
- Multiple breakdowns in the past 2 years
- Energy bills have increased 30%+ with no rate change
- Uneven temperatures throughout the home
The $5,000 Rule: Multiply the repair cost by the unit's age in years. If the result exceeds $5,000, replacement is almost always the better financial decision.
